Description:This Plan provides a benchmark of stated goals and targets in order to track coral restoration progress at prioritized sites on St. Croix and St. Thomas. Through a coordinated and cooperative process, VI-RoCS chose six priority sites including two on St. Thomas and four on St. Croix.
